Godot logo

Godot Beginner Tutorials

Start your game development journey with Godot. These beginner tutorials will help you master the basics and build your first game.

Indie Development2D GamesOpen Source ProjectsSmall TeamsPrototyping

Recommended Learning Path

1

Get Familiar with the Engine

Start by installing Godot and getting familiar with the user interface and basic concepts.

Estimated time: 1-2 hours
2

Follow a Basic Tutorial

Complete a step-by-step tutorial to create your first simple game or project.

Estimated time: 2-4 hours
3

Learn the Core Concepts

Deepen your understanding of Godot by learning about core concepts like physics, animation, and scripting.

Estimated time: 5-10 hours
4

Build Your Own Project

Apply what you've learned by building your own small game or interactive project.

Estimated time: 10-20 hours

Recommended Tutorials and Resources

Step by Step Guide
Free
Official step-by-step introduction to Godot Engine
Source: GodotVisit
Your First 2D Game
Free
Learn to make your first complete 2D game with Godot
Source: GodotVisit
Godot Documentation
Free
Comprehensive documentation covering all aspects of Godot development
Source: GodotVisit

Community Forums

Join the Godot community to get help, share your projects, and learn from others.

Visit Forums

Asset Store

Explore pre-made assets, tools, and resources to enhance your Godot projects.

Browse Assets

Documentation

Explore the comprehensive documentation for Godot to learn about all features and capabilities.

Read Docs

Need help with Godot?

Our experienced game developers can provide personalized guidance and training.